Republican Brogdon Enters Race for Oklahoma Governor

Republican state Sen. Randy Brogdon on Saturday announced his campaign for Oklahoma governor, complicating Republican Rep. Mary Fallin’s own quest for the party’s nomination.

“I’m Randy Brogdon. I’m a conservative and I’m running for governor,” Brogdon announced April 18 at the state party GOP convention in Oklahoma City.  

Fallin, also a conservative, was re-elected in November to a second term representing the Oklahoma City-area 5th District. Fallin retains a statewide profile stemming from her service as Oklahoma’s lieutenant governor from 1995 to 2007.
